What Is Technology?

Technology is the practical application of scientific knowledge to create tools, systems, machines, and processes that solve problems and improve human life. It includes both physical inventions and digital solutions designed to increase efficiency, productivity, and convenience.

Technology exists in countless forms, including:

  • Computers and laptops
  • Smartphones and tablets
  • Internet services
  • Medical equipment
  • Transportation systems
  • Industrial machinery
  • Robotics
  • Artificial intelligence
  • Renewable energy systems

Its primary purpose is to make tasks easier while improving accuracy, speed, and accessibility.

The Evolution of Technology

Technology has evolved continuously throughout human history.

Ancient Technology

Early civilizations developed simple technologies such as:

  • Stone tools
  • Fire
  • Agriculture
  • Pottery
  • Irrigation systems
  • The wheel

These inventions laid the foundation for civilization and economic growth.

Industrial Revolution

The Industrial Revolution introduced machinery powered by steam and electricity, allowing factories to produce goods on a massive scale. Transportation also improved through railways and steamships.

This period marked one of the greatest technological transformations in history.

The Computer Revolution

The invention of computers changed the way information is processed and stored. Businesses, governments, and educational institutions quickly adopted computers to improve efficiency.

The development of the internet further accelerated global communication and information sharing.

Artificial Intelligence

Artificial Intelligence enables machines to simulate human intelligence by learning from data, recognizing patterns, and making decisions.

Examples include:

  • Voice assistants
  • Recommendation systems
  • Language translation
  • Facial recognition
  • Fraud detection
  • Customer service chatbots

AI is transforming industries by improving automation and decision-making.

Cloud Computing

Cloud computing provides computing services through the internet instead of relying on physical hardware.

Benefits include:

  • Remote access
  • Lower operational costs
  • Scalable infrastructure
  • Secure backups
  • Faster collaboration
  • Improved flexibility

Cloud technology enables businesses to operate from virtually anywhere.

Internet of Things

The Internet of Things connects everyday devices to the internet, allowing them to collect and exchange data automatically.

Common IoT devices include:

  • Smart watches
  • Home security systems
  • Smart lighting
  • Connected vehicles
  • Industrial sensors
  • Smart farming equipment

IoT improves automation and provides real-time information.

Cybersecurity

As digital systems become increasingly connected, cybersecurity has become a major priority.

Cybersecurity protects computer systems against threats including:

  • Malware
  • Phishing
  • Ransomware
  • Data breaches
  • Identity theft
  • Unauthorized access

Strong passwords, encryption, firewalls, and multi-factor authentication help improve digital security.

Challenges of Technology

Despite its many advantages, technology also presents several challenges.

Data Privacy

Organizations collect vast amounts of personal information, making privacy protection increasingly important.

Cybercrime

Hackers constantly develop sophisticated attacks targeting businesses, governments, and individuals.

Job Automation

Automation replaces some repetitive jobs while increasing demand for advanced technical skills.

Digital Divide

Many communities still lack reliable internet access and modern digital infrastructure.

Closing this gap remains a global challenge.

Ethical Concerns

Emerging technologies raise important ethical issues involving:

  • AI decision-making
  • Surveillance
  • Data ownership
  • Facial recognition
  • Deepfake technology
  • Algorithm bias

Responsible development requires transparency, accountability, and regulation.
